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 1103.00 cc 1200.00 cc
Engine Desmosedici Stradale 90° V4, counter-rotating crankshaft, 4 Desmodromic timing, 4 valves per cylinder Liquid cooled, 8 valve, SOHC, 270° crank angle parallel twin
Engine Starting -- Electric
Clutch Hydraulically controlled slipper and self-servo wet multiplate clutch. Self bleeding master cylinder. Wet, multi-plate torque assist clutch
Fuel System Electronic fuel injection system. Twin injectors per cylinder.Full ride-by-wire elliptical throttle bodies. Variable length intake system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ection
Cooling System Liquid-cooled Liquid cooled
Maximum Power 215.5 PS @ 13000 RPM 80 PS @ 6550 RPM
Maximum Torque 123.6 NM (91.2 lb-ft) @ 9500 RPM 105 Nm @ 3500 RPM
Seating Capacity 2 --
Transmission 6-speed with Ducati Quick Shift (DQS) up/down EVO 2 6-speed
Gear Shift Pattern 1-N-2-3-4-5-6 1-N-2-3--4-5-6
Drivetrain -- Final Drive:Chain
Top Speed 299 kmph --
Riding Modes -- Two riding modes
Display Last generation digital unit with 5" TFT colour display Twin dial analogue speedometer and tachometer with LCD multi-functional displays
Frame Aluminum alloy "Front Frame" with optimized stiffnesses Tubular steel, twin cradle frame
